Transaction f91ef7d5d99bf338aa566c6fd335c1769679cec4877f1e85d85526d3ac7a5605
1 Input
1 Output
-
f91ef7d5d99bf338aa566c6fd335c1769679cec4877f1e85d85526d3ac7a5605:0
- value
- 1024439
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18a36bb378794c31495b19a2eb1e547198f07750 OP_EQUAL
- address
- 33wHupNGiaa8DBo34aBoaKkddYbfBhAAuZ